Heat transfer characteristics of plate-fin heat sinks enhanced by piezoelectric fans

H.-P. Hsua, P.-T. Wub, H. Ayb

a Air Force Institute of Technology, Kaohsiung
b National Kaohsiung First University of Science and Technology, Kaohsiung

Abstract: In this study, the thermal and fluid flow characteristics of a piezoelectric fan are experimentally evaluated by altering its height and distance from single-fin and plate-fin heat sinks. Based on the thermal resistance of heat sinks, the piezoelectric fan performance is assessed. Particle image velocimetry is used to study the flow velocity field generated by the piezoelectric fan.

Keywords: infrared thermography, piezoelectric fan, plate-fin heat sinks, thermal resistance.
